The seventh day after the birth of the lateral incision wound is still hot, such as no other symptoms of discomfort, is a normal phenomenon; such as bleeding or redness and swelling phenomenon is anomalous, and need to be checked and treated in a timely manner. 1. Normal phenomenon: postpartum lateral incision needs a healing time, generally in 1 ~ 2 weeks or so, the seventh day after delivery of the lateral incision wound hot and spicy may be caused by the wound has not healed well, as long as there is no local redness and swelling and abnormal secretion, bleeding phenomenon is normal, you can pay attention to the local hygiene, temporary observation, to keep the wound clean and dry. 2. Abnormal phenomenon: most of the lateral incision in about a week there will be no obvious pain discomfort, the seventh day of the wound is still hot and spicy may be caused by slow recovery of the wound, but it may also be related to local infection, usually accompanied by redness, swelling, bleeding, edema and other phenomena at the wound. Once the above symptoms are abnormal, need to consult a doctor in time, and under the guidance of the doctor to give targeted treatment.
